Common Issues and Errors Related to 11901.mfc140.dll
DLL files, despite their significant role in system functionality, can sometimes trigger system error messages. The subsequent list features some the most common DLL error messages that users may encounter.
- This application failed to start because 11901.mfc140.dll was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This message suggests that the application is trying to run a DLL file that it can't locate, which may be due to deletion or displacement of the DLL file. Reinstallation could potentially restore the necessary DLL file to its correct location.
- The file 11901.mfc140.dll is missing: The specified DLL file couldn't be found. It may have been unintentionally deleted or moved from its original location.
- 11901.mfc140.dll not found: This indicates that the application you're trying to run is looking for a specific DLL file that it can't locate. This could be due to the DLL file being missing, corrupted, or incorrectly installed.
- 11901.mfc140.dll could not be loaded: This means that the DLL file required by a specific program or process could not be loaded into memory. This could be due to corruption of the DLL file, improper installation, or compatibility issues with your operating system.
- 11901.mfc140.dll Access Violation: This points to a situation where a process has attempted to interact with 11901.mfc140.dll in a way that violates system or application rules. This might be due to incorrect programming, memory overflows, or the running process lacking necessary permissions.

Perform a System Restore to Fix Dll Errors
In this guide, we provide steps to perform a System Restore.
-
Press the Windows key.
-
Type
System Restore
in the search bar and press Enter. -
Click on Create a restore point.
-
In the System Properties window, under the System Protection tab, click on System Restore....
-
Click Next in the System Restore window.
-
Choose a restore point from the list. Ideally, select a point when you know the system was working well.
